Output 10598798e5551d9cbbbb4e95feb6c7e5d9e9f94357b33a901215ce3cb613daab:3

value
15000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29dcadb248b56faffbb76c3e9b6a2a19f2f4e1b0 OP_EQUALVERIFY OP_CHECKSIG
address
14pM4spMtHjxQdndDcq2oSvvkeDHjKbctq
transaction
10598798e5551d9cbbbb4e95feb6c7e5d9e9f94357b33a901215ce3cb613daab
spent
true